Some felt Rachel Reilly was robbed of the prize money, thanks to the hamster wheel, which led to the producers receiving death threats. On that note, will the wheel return?
For those who weren’t watching this season on CBS or streaming Big Brother online with a Paramount+ subscription, Season 13 winner Rachel Reilly returned to play and was shockingly eliminated without a proper eviction after failing the surprise “Hamster Wheel” challenge. There was quite a public outcry from fans over the incident, but it would seem it was more extreme for the producers.
Big Brother’s Allison Grodner Received Death Threats After The Hamster Wheel
EW, Big Brother producers Allison Grodner and Rich Meehan confirmed they were aware of the fan response to the Hamster Wheel twist being brought from Reindeer Games to the franchise’s flagship show. Grodner even mentioned she’d received death threats from fans upset about Rachel’s eviction.
